Ca’n Terra项目是一座属于大地的居所。设计以自然的馈赠为基础,经过精心耕耘,将其转化成了富有家庭氛围的空间。通过不断将想法变为现实,人类的文明得以发展;这个项目则反其道而行之,用建筑诠释历史。设计的过程不再是从图纸到建筑实体,而是将已有体块转化为电子数据,用建筑的方式探索其几何内涵。
Ca’n Terra is the house of the earth. The fruit that nature gives us, as a found space; which requires tillage and cultivation to imbue the received offering with domesticity. If the history of civilization has greatly evolved transforming ideas into built work, in Ca’n Terra, the process is inverted and history interpreted to transform it into architecture. The transfer from drawing to built mass gives way to the translation of given matter to digital data through the architectural reading of a geological discovery.

空间原本是Mares采石场,具有工业逻辑;而作为人工采挖的壮观洞穴,其艺术潜能也不容忽视;此外,它还是Menorca岛屿上岩石景观的一部分,拥有矿物属性。找到这样一个在大地中挖出的空间,并将其转化成其他功能意味着要赋予空间新的叙事,以避免被废弃的命运。第一次来到这个空间时,设计师仿佛是探险者,装备了探照灯等照明工具,在岩石连续皱褶的表面上设置了无数镭射点,以进行毫米级的精确结构构建,再由设计师将其打磨成适宜居住的环境。在扫描的基础上,建筑师通过专业决策,诠释并重构了整个空间。因此,这次探索可以被看成一项新的工作,将洞穴变成可以思考自然的房间。无数壮观的建筑凌驾于环境之上,而此次项目的设计深入到了环境内部,找出其中供人生活的自由空间。

Project: Ca’n Terra
Location: Menorca, Spain
Date of project: 2018 – 2020
End of building construction: In progress
Author of the project: Antón García-Abril & Debora Mesa Molina
Project team: Ensamble Studio, Javier Cuesta (building engineer), Borja Soriano (project manager), Claudia Armas, Alvaro Catalan, Massimo Loia, Marco Antrodicchia, Sebastián Zapata, Arianna Sebastiani, Ekam Sahni, Yu-Ting Li, Joel Kim, Gonzalo Peña, Barbara Doroszuk, Yvonne Asiimwe, Mónica Acosta
Developer: Ensamble Studio
Construction management: Ensamble Studio
Consultants: Urculo engineering (MEP)
Built area: 1 000 m²
Photo credits: Ensamble Studio, Iwan Baan
